We thought twelve new products in July would be the year\u2019s low point, but August proved us wrong with only nine new listings.\u00a0 This was the slowest pace since October 2010 and only the third time in three years launches failed to reach double-digits in a calendar month.\u00a0 Three ETN closures accompanied the eight new ETFs and one ETN, putting the net increase at just six.\u00a0 The number of listed products totaled 1,301 at the end of August: 1,131 ETFs and 170 ETNs.\u00a0 Actively-managed ETFs held steady at 40.<\/p>\n

Trading typically slows in August, but this year surged 99% from July.\u00a0 Total monthly dollar volume across all ETPs surpassed $2.9 trillion.\u00a0 ETN trading activity was up 209% to $73 billion. \u00a0An average day in August saw $127 billion of ETPs change hands.<\/p>\n

The number of ETFs averaging more than $1 billion in daily trading activity (the Billion Dollar Club) doubled to twenty and accounted for more than 73% of all ETP dollars traded.\u00a0 SPDR S&P 500 (SPY) alone accounted for more than 36% of all ETP trading activity.<\/p>\n

Products averaging more than $100 million of trading per day jumped from 76 to 100 and accounted for more than 93% of all dollars traded.\u00a0 Products averaging more than $10 million of trading per day increased from 234 to 289, grabbing nearly 99% of all ETP dollars traded.<\/p>\n

Industry assets under management was $1.06 trillion at the end of August, a decrease of -3.9% for the month and a gain of +5.4% year-to-date.<\/p>\n

New products launched in August<\/strong>\u00a0(in chronological order), along with links to analysis of each:<\/p>\n

    \n
  1. EGShares Emerging Markets High Income Low Beta ETF (HILO) [Emerging Markets+High Income+Low Beta=HILO<\/a>]<\/li>\n
  2. Rydex S&P MidCap 400 Equal Weight ETF (EWMD) [EWMD, EWSM: New Equal-Weight ETFs from Rydex<\/a>]<\/li>\n
  3. Rydex S&P SmallCap 600 Equal Weight ETF (EWSM)<\/li>\n
  4. EGShares India Consumer ETF (INCO) [INCO: India Consumer ETF Begins Trading<\/a>]<\/li>\n
  5. Market Vectors Mortgage REIT Income ETF (MORT) [Latching On to a Double-Digit Yield with MORT<\/a>]<\/li>\n
  6. iPath S&P 500 Dynamic VIX ETN (XVZ) [XVZ: A Dynamic Volatility Strategy ETN<\/a>]<\/li>\n
  7. iShares MSCI Emerging Markets Small Cap Index Fund (EEMS) [iShares Joins Emerging Markets Small Cap ETF Party<\/a>]<\/li>\n
  8. iShares S&P Target Date 2045 Index Fund (TZW) [iShares Target Date Series Extended to 2050<\/a>]<\/li>\n
  9. iShares S&P Target Date 2050 Index Fund (TZY)<\/li>\n<\/ol>\n

    Product closures\/delistings in August<\/strong>:<\/p>\n

      \n
    1. ELEMENTS Benjamin Graham Total Market Value Index-Total Return ETN (BVT) [Ben Graham ELEMENTS ETNs Closing Today<\/a>]<\/li>\n
    2. ELEMENTS Benjamin Graham Large Cap Value Index-Total Return ETN (BVL)<\/li>\n
    3. ELEMENTS Benjamin Graham Small Cap Value Index-Total Return ETN (BSC)<\/li>\n<\/ol>\n

      Product changes in August:<\/strong><\/p>\n

      None<\/p>\n

      Announced Product Changes for Coming Months:<\/strong><\/p>\n

        \n
      1. FaithShares announced its last remaining fund, FaithShares Christian Values (FOC), would close in September with the last day of trading set for 8\/31\/11.<\/li>\n
      2. PowerShares Active AlphaQ (PQY) and PowerShares Active Alpha Multi-Cap (PQZ) will close and liquidate after the last day of trading on 9\/30\/11.<\/li>\n
      3. Van Eck Global and Merrill Lynch announced (8\/12\/11 press release) an agreement to seek SEC and shareholder approval for a fourth quarter 2011 exchange of six HOLDRS products into similar to-be-released Market Vector ETFs.<\/li>\n<\/ol>\n
